2.2.7 (b) JAI, Inc. Power Cables

If you are using JAI, Inc. power cables such as the 12P-02S, please refer to the 12-pin connector pin-out
diagram in “12-Pin Connector (TM-2016-8)” on page 6. The cable pin-out diagram is shown in
Figure 6 below. The color-coded leads use Gray for Ground and Yellow for +12V.

FIGURE 6.

12P-02S Interface Cable (optional)

Note: Make sure that the unused leads are not touching and that there is no possibility that

exposed wires could cause the leads to short.

2.2.7 (c) “K” Series Power Supplies

The “K” series power supplies are designed primarily for OEM users who will be mounting the power
supply inside a protective enclosure. For use in exposed situations, the PD-12UU series power supplies
are recommended.

1.

Attach the 110V line cord to the two terminals marked “AC.” Do not plug the cord into a 110V AC

socket until you have completed steps 1 through 3.

2.

Attach the Gray and Yellow leads of the power cable to the Ground and 12V DC terminals, respec-

tively.

3.

Replace the plastic terminal guard on the power supply.

2.2.7 (d) Building Your Own Power Cable

Refer to the 12-pin connector pin-out in Section 2.2.2 (a on page 6. Connect the Ground lead to pin #1,
and the +12V DC lead to pin #2 of the 12-pin connector. Power must be DC-regulated, and of sufficient
current to properly power the camera.
